Transaction 60fa28625e662a301c56ec4819aa9fd1bfcbe46dd6b00200125937547010c589
1 Input
1 Output
-
60fa28625e662a301c56ec4819aa9fd1bfcbe46dd6b00200125937547010c589:0
- value
- 27448
- script pubkey
- OP_0 OP_PUSHBYTES_20 426578710289e2ba45ce1ae69e5b825132044a91
- address
- bc1qgfjhsugz383t53wwrtnfukuz2yeqgj53d8keuc